ASUS N50V 15.4″ Notebook

 ASUS N50V 15.4″ Notebook

The N50V is a stylish 15.4-inch notebook computer for students as well as home users who are looking for a powerful multimedia laptop and doesn’t mind paying high bucks for it. The latest addition in ASUS’ N-Series is very similar to N20A in designing. But specs-wise both are quite different. It boasts the Super Hybrid Engine (SHE) which consists of the Power4 Gear Hybrid application and the Energy Processing Unit (EPU), providing up to 35% more battery life. Also on the offer is Express Gate for 8sec boot up, facial recognition technology, fingerprint reader, and built-in Air Ionizer that not only helps clean the air around the user of allergens and germs, but also promotes air-flow and circulation.

The SSD version available in Japan on July 12th

asus_u2e_2.jpg

Asus Japan announced their U2E notebook equipped with a 11.1-Inch LCD Screen in WXGA Resolution (1366×768 ), features now 32GB of SSD Driver, and will be available on July 12th for 1770€.
The U2E is powered by a Core 2 Duo U7600 CPU (1.20GHz), and features 2GB of RAM (up to 4GB), Mobile Intel GM965 Express chipset, as well as WiFi a/b/g/n, Bluetooth 2.0, multicar-reader, 0.3 Megapixel camera, fingerprint sensor, and micro-DVI.

ASUS intros two notebooks with AMD Turion X2 Ultras

ASUS announced the launch of two next-generation notebook computers with the recently introducesd AMD Turion X2 Ultra dual-core mobile processors. The 15.4-inch widescreen F5Z and 14-inch F8Tr notebooks share ATI’s Radeon HD 3000-series graphics cards for improved graphics and video processing. Along with the rest of the ASUS notebook range, either new notebook PC offers a proprietary operating system that grants access to programs such as Internet, email and chat programs just eight seconds after powering up the laptop. The F5Z sports an integrated 1.3-megapixel swiveling web cam, and the company’s LCD adjustment technology. Other specs are thin, but apart from the CPU and graphics chipset, should share many of the same hardware and software as other laptops in ASUS’ F5-series, most closely resembling the F5N content levels.

The F8Tr’s body is made using the company’s high-tech manufacturing process for scratch-resistant surfaces. It also features a high-resolution webcam that is capable of scanning a user’s face thanks to the company’s SmartLogon technology, along with a fingerprint scanner for security. Bluetooth and WLAN 802.11 a/g/n wireless connection options are integrated as well.

ASUS has not announced release date or prices for its newest offerings.

ASUS ROG’s new gaming pc ‘G70′ utilizing multi dual-engine

asus-g70.JPG

ASUS Republic of Gamers(ROG) has produced an exceptional range of gaming products to give gamers the ultimate gaming edge. These advanced gaming hardware are geared for the future, and showcased at Computex 2008.

In particular, ‘G70′ utilizes a multi dual-engine architecture to answer gamer needs for extreme performance, by adopting Intel Core 2 Duo / Extreme CPU, dual independent Nvidia 8700M GT VGA cards, dual HDD with a combined mass storage capacity up to 640GB and dual thermal fans.

The G70 provides high-definition visuals and audio capabilities that sets a new standard in mobile gaming. It also offers special lighting and material designs that enhances the gaming atmosphere; as well as dual screens for display of critical system info and messages for disruption-free gaming.

A dual mode touch pad and the gaming-themed keyboard with special key highlights provide easy access to multimedia controls as well as additional hotkeys.
